Output e8c6db5487b00a0a650b37508c41c43377bbb996149629a19b98f1c8dddcaaf9:0

value
677000
script pubkey
OP_0 OP_PUSHBYTES_20 ee0615d98cc2d513f417fe381912225a21e6a7d9
address
bc1qacrptkvvct238aqhlcupjy3ztgs7df7e667dzu
transaction
e8c6db5487b00a0a650b37508c41c43377bbb996149629a19b98f1c8dddcaaf9
confirmations
70270
spent
true